Job Title: Aviation Audit Manager
Job Location: Any Nationality
Vacancy: 1 Vacancy
Main Responsibilities:
- Establish, document, develop and manage the Quality System and ensure compliance with regulatory requirements and business needs.
- Identify business process risks within the area being audited.
- Develop testing methodologies to evaluate the adequacy of controls.
- Document and control the quality records.
- Support the development and improvement of the QMS.
- Develop recommendations and reports based on audits.
- Plan and allocate resources and individuals in accordance with skills and schedules.
- Develop professional development procedures for direct reports.
- Organize and distribute resources and manpower in harmony with abilities and schedules.
- Produce reports that outline problems and provide prospective workarounds.
- Liaise with internal and external stakeholders for audits.
- Ensure health and safety of themselves, company assets, and others.
- Cooperate with the QHSE department and attend required training.
- Follow health and safety requirements of the workplace.
- Report any hazards in the workplace.
- Carry out duties in a resource-efficient way and actively support THC's Environmental Policy.
- Actively seek to reduce waste in the workplace or use environmentally friendly products.
- Promote and support environmental practices.
- Monitor staff achievements, perform periodic performance appraisals, and provide guidance, coaching, or training to direct subordinates.
- Optimize the use of personal and team time/effort in carrying out assigned duties to ensure work meets agreed standards for timeliness and quality.
- Ensure continuous monitoring of trends in the market and provide advice to management on potential initiatives.
- Support the execution of the overall strategic vision.

Experience & Skills:
- 7 years of experience in Auditing.
- Background knowledge in GACARs, Labor Law, and any relevant regulations.
- Working experience within the aviation field is advantageous.
- Ability to identify hazards, risks, perform risk assessment, and build safety cases.
- Adequate knowledge of safety standards and safety investigations.
- Possess good work habits, team-oriented, strong work ethics, and adhere to company work hours, policies, and standards of business etiquette.
Qualifications:
- Bachelor's degree in risk management, business management, aerospace engineering, or equivalent experience.
- Certified Internal Auditor or any relevant certification is a plus.
- Certified Lead Auditor or any relevant certification is a plus.
